Raise and Renew: Let’s visit an Idaho ranch that is producing more than food!

At Lazy JM Ranch, they are producing more than food. They are building a future for the next generation of Idaho agriculture.

On this Farm Family Friday, Idaho Preferred introduces us to the Mobbs, who raise beef while renewing the land.
